This means for every $10 you bet on Red in American Roulette, you expect to lose $0.526 in the long run. This -$0.526 is precisely the house edge of 5.26% applied to your $10 bet. Every bet in a casino game has a negative expected value for the player. The house edge (HE) or vigorish is defined as the casino profit expressed as a percentage of the player’s original bet. RNG hardware generates thousands of random numbers every second. So on one hand, you will change the outcome of the next round if you press the start button one second later. However, on the other hand, you have no chance to predict whether the outcome will be better for you or not. Modern RNGs used in online casinos are dedicated hardware devices that generate random numbers out of electromagnetic noise. It’s like an old television without signal – a lot of black and white dots. Take a photo of a small part of a TV screen, convert the pixels into 1s and 0s, write them into a text file and you have a random number.

While Pearson only analysed previous Roulette results, others tried to use mathematics to increase their chances of winning in casinos. One of these was Edward Thorp, who invented card counting – a technique that allowed him to beat casinos at Blackjack.

For example, blackjack has a theoretical Return to Player of around 99%. Baccarat has above 98%, video poker above 99.5%, keno around 70%, and so on. Moreover, I’d like to remind you that some games may also have individual bets with different RTPs. Roulette consists of a wheel with the numbers from 1 to 36 coloured in red and black, as well as a green 0. A ball rolls around the outside and randomly lands on one of the numbers. Gamblers can bet on a single number, a set of multiple numbers, or just a colour.

A player betting in a game with a 4% house advantage will tend to lose his money twice as fast as a player making bets with a 2% house edge. The trick to intelligent casino gambling – at least from the mathematical expectation point of view – is to avoid the games and bets with the large house advantages.
